On Saturday, the Steelers verbally agreed for Mike McCarthy to become the team's head coach
McCarthy has spent 18 seasons as a head coach in the NFL, 13 with the Green Bay Packers (2006-18) and five with the Dallas Cowboys (2020-24).
McCarthy, who is a Pittsburgh native, has a 174-112-2 overall coaching record and led the Packers to a Super Bowl XLV championship. He has the second-most career wins (125) in Packers' history.
During his time with the Cowboys, he had three 12-win seasons and led them to the playoffs three times in five seasons.
McCarthy also spent time with the New Orleans Saints and San Francisco 49ers as the offensive coordinator for both franchises.
